ZIP code 49815 is located in Channing, Michigan, within Dickinson County. It covers approximately 126.71 square miles and serves a population of 205 residents. This is a standard ZIP code in the Central (CT) timezone, served by area code 906.

About ZIP code 49815

The housing stock consists of predominantly single-family detached homes. Most homes were built in the 1990s,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$110,200.

Median household income is $74,750. 54% of households receive Social Security income, suggesting a notable retiree or disability population.

The dominant occupation class is production, transportation, and material moving,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. The average commute of 24 minutes is near the national average.

Educational attainment is near the national average, with 29% of residents holding a bachelor's degree or higher.

Health indicators show elevated rates of smoking (21%) compared to national benchmarks.

Overall, ZIP code 49815 reflects a community defined by high homeownership and a significant Social Security-dependent population.
